Output 86f0427c31734b8d7e3f411c4fccc517444eed599872ef29dd1dcd66852147c0:0

value
32170053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53037908201964891c95abda3ebbfef64e98fe3a OP_EQUAL
address
39FxAkxT7hLQ8unTAooDFnysoaf3ZKaEYp
transaction
86f0427c31734b8d7e3f411c4fccc517444eed599872ef29dd1dcd66852147c0
spent
true